linux中反应负载的命令

不及物动词 其他 14

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中,我们可以使用一些命令来反应系统的负载情况。以下是一些常用的命令:

    1. uptime:这个命令会显示系统的运行时间,以及平均负载。平均负载是系统在特定时间段内的平均活跃进程数。一般来说,在无阻塞状态下,应该尽量保持平均负载低于系统核心数量的两倍。

    2. top:这个命令可以实时地显示系统的运行状况,包括负载情况、CPU使用情况、内存使用情况等。通过按键“1”可以显示每个CPU核心的使用情况。

    3. w:这个命令会显示当前登录用户的信息,以及平均负载。它可以提供一个快速的方式来了解系统的负载情况。

    4. vmstat:这个命令可以提供详细的系统统计信息,包括运行进程数量、内存使用情况、CPU使用情况等。

    5. sar:这个命令可以提供历史统计数据,包括CPU使用情况、内存使用情况、IO使用情况等。通过设置不同的参数,可以获取不同时间段的统计数据。

    这些命令可以帮助我们了解系统的负载情况,从而进行性能优化和故障排查。在分析负载情况时,除了关注平均负载的数值,还需要结合其他参数来综合判断系统的运行状况。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ux中,有几个命令可以帮助您了解系统的负载状况。以下是其中一些命令:

    1. `top`命令:top命令是一个非常常用的命令,可以显示系统当前的负载情况,以及运行的进程、CPU利用率、内存使用情况等。在命令行中输入`top`即可打开top界面。

    2. `uptime`命令:uptime命令可以显示系统的负载状况和运行时间。它会显示系统的当前时间、系统已运行的时间、当前登录用户数以及平均负载。

    3. `w`命令:w命令可以显示系统的当前负载情况以及用户的登录信息。它会显示每个登录用户的用户名、登录时间、终端名称以及负载情况。

    4. `vmstat`命令:vmstat命令用于监视系统的虚拟内存、进程、IO、CPU和系统活动等信息。它会显示有关系统资源利用率的详细统计信息。

    5. `sar`命令:sar命令是系统活动报告(System Activity Reporter)的缩写,可以收集和报告系统的性能数据。它能够提供关于CPU利用率、内存使用、磁盘I/O等方面的详细统计信息。

    这些命令可以帮助您监视系统的负载情况,以便及时了解系统资源的使用情况并进行相应的调整和优化。通过运用这些命令,您可以更好地管理和维护您的Linux系统。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,可以使用一些命令来查看系统的负载情况。以下是一些常用的命令:

    1. uptime命令:uptime命令会显示系统当前的运行时间以及平均负载。其中,平均负载是指在过去的1分钟、5分钟和15分钟内,系统处于运行队列中的平均进程数量。通过运行`uptime`命令,我们可以直接查看系统的负载情况。

    2. top命令:top命令可以实时显示系统的负载情况,包括CPU的使用率、内存的使用情况以及各个进程的状态。在top命令的输出结果中,负载情况通常由load average字段表示,后面的三个数字分别表示1分钟、5分钟和15分钟的平均负载。

    3. w命令:w命令可以显示当前登录用户以及他们的运行进程。它也会显示系统的平均负载情况,与uptime命令类似。

    4. sar命令:sar命令可以收集和报告系统资源使用情况的历史数据。通过sar命令,我们可以查看系统的平均负载以及CPU、内存、磁盘、网络等方面的使用情况历史数据。

    5. mpstat命令:mpstat命令用于显示多处理器系统上的每个处理器的负载情况。它可以提供有关每个处理器的平均负载、空闲时间、用户时间和系统时间的信息。

    6. pidstat命令:pidstat命令可以提供有关特定进程的资源使用情况的实时报告。它可以显示进程的CPU占用率、内存使用情况、I/O操作以及上下文切换等信息。

    7. vmstat命令:vmstat命令可以提供有关系统的虚拟内存、系统、I/O以及CPU情况的实时报告。通过运行vmstat命令,我们可以查看系统的负载情况以及各个方面的性能指标。

    以上是一些常见的Linux命令,可以帮助我们查看系统的负载情况。根据具体的需求,选择适合的命令来进行查看和分析。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部